Transaction e06dd2ceddf2f16ea7162f2f16cebfbf7cfb01e22fdabbc4f886a3128d7278bb
1 Input
1 Outputs
- e06dd2ceddf2f16ea7162f2f16cebfbf7cfb01e22fdabbc4f886a3128d7278bb:0
value 21808697
address 1E5XzHXSnp1RFefvgi5CDQpT1renxwRJt4